🌄 Early Seagull Gets the Fry

To avoid crowds and the summer heat, we aimed to get to the Jersey shore by 10:30am. There was a perfect amount of people where we felt relaxed to walk leisurely, shops weren’t packed, and food stalls didn’t have long lines. Since we got there so early, we were able to walk from end to end of the boardwalk within 3 hours and leave before it was the hottest time of the day.

🚙 Pay to Park

We opted to pay for a parking lot spot. Your frugal self may be wondering why when there could be free spots, but we didn’t want to waste time circling for parking nor potentially park far from the boardwalk. This meant less time in the car seat and more time for activities. To put it into perspective, we paid $20, which is just the cost of one nice cocktail. Worth it. 🙂

👶 Use a Wagon for Travel Ease

With both Baby Bao and my nephew, bringing our wagon was an AMAZING decision. It carried them both with space to spare, as well as all the usuals from our diaper bag so we didn’t need to lug it around. We have one with a canopy too that provided extra shade for the babies.

😋 Bring & Buy Snacks

I think this is probably a given for any outing with kids, but we had a new container of puffs and bought more snacks along the boardwalk to keep our little foodie happy. Baby Bao enjoyed boardwalk fries from our favorite joint, pizza from the famous Manco & Manco, and Dippin’ Dots! It was so nostalgic to share these with her.

🖌 Brush on the Sunscreen

I don’t know who else needs to hear this hack, but USE A MAKEUP BRUSH TO APPLY SUNSCREEN! It’s such a gamechanger. No more sticky hands and a writhing baby for this oh-so-important task. We have a dedicated makeup brush and it makes applying (and re-applying) baby sunscreen so much easier and quicker.
